Zcash Prepares for Block Size Boost
Zcash, a leading privacy-focused cryptocurrency, is gearing up for its next major network upgrade. The upgrade, set to take place in April, aims to increase the block size and improve scalability.
The current block size limit of 2MB has been a long-standing issue for Zcash, causing high transaction fees and delayed confirmations. By increasing this limit, the new upgrade will enable faster and cheaper transactions, making Zcash more competitive with other major cryptocurrencies.
The exact date of the upgrade has not been confirmed, but developers have stated that it will happen in April. The community is eagerly awaiting the upgrade, which is expected to bring significant improvements to the network's performance and user experience.
